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
701218 96174 88
678746051 914637 9322534123
678746051 914637 9322534123
038138 66612515 202678 2220 5323
All about undefined
Interested in learning more?
678746051 914637 9322534123
038138 66612515 202678 2220 5323
See more
16451818 348060827 905944
4257551167 8413631229 080326
See more
178 362112327
40 71 1715946851
See more